Honestly, what I would like to see in a new pack/DLC is:

  • campaign for Lithuania (only nation, for now, without even a single scenario), which could be connected with Crusades, Teutonic Order.
  • a proper campaign for Slavs (Dracula doesn’t count for me): Kievan Rus/Novgorod/Muscovy - Russian princedoms.
  • one of the most important nations in Asia (Japanese, Chinese) should get new campaigns. Campaign about Korea would be nice addition too.

EDIT: Filthydelphia made great one-scenario campaign about emperor Alexios Komnenos. It would be nice to play this officialy as a 5-scenario campaign!

New nations in the future could be, for example: Georgians, Swiss, Poland/Bohemia (to have represantation for Western Slavs), Habsburgs/Austria (I’ve read that they were considered for The Conquerors), maybe Tibetans, Siam/Thailand.
